How to Remove Wax Build-Up on Hardwood Floors

WebDec 19, 2024 · 1. Moisten a cloth with mineral spirits, which is available at any hardware store. Rub down a small area of the floor -- an area of about two feet square is about the right size. WebIf it leaves a WHITE mark where the water was = waxed finish. If the water beads on the floor long enough to be wiped up, you have finish on them. If they are truly 'raw' the water will absorb IMMEDIATELY. You will have NOTHING to wipe up.
